362 Blackburn Road, Darwen, BB3 0AA is a leasehold terraced property built before 1900. The property offers approximately 872 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have three b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£158,479 , which equates to approximately £182 per square foot. It was last sold on 16 Dec 2022 for £143,000. Since then, the value has increased by £15,479, representing a 10.8% increase, or approximately 3.6% per year.

The current estimated value of £158,479 is:

  • 26.8% higher than the average property price on Blackburn Road
  • 37.4% higher than the average in the BB3 0AA postcode area
  • and 10.2% lower than the average price for Darwen as a whole

This property has had 2 EPC inspections with recorded tenure information. It was recorded as owner-occupied both times. This suggests the property has typically been lived in by its owners, which often reflects longer-term residency and more consistent maintenance.

At the most recent EPC inspection on 23 June 2022, the property was recorded as owner-occupied.

EPC Summary

362 Blackburn Road, Darwen, Blackburn With Darwen, BB3 0AA has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of E, based on the latest assessment carried out on 23 Jun 2022.

This property uses electric room heaters as its main heating source. Electric instantaneous heaters at the point of use are used to provide hot water.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 5 Oct 2021, when the property was rated F. Since then, the rating has improved to E, with the energy efficiency score increasing by 28.1%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The heating system was upgraded from room heaters, mains gas to room heaters, electric, changing energy efficiency from poor to very poor.
  • The hot water system was changed from gas multipoint to electric instantaneous at point of use, with its energy efficiency changing from average to very poor.
  • The roof construction or insulation changed from pitched, no insulation (assumed) to pitched, 150 mm loft insulation, improving energy efficiency from very poor to good.
  • The lighting was changed from low energy lighting in 88% of fixed outlets to low energy lighting in all fixed outlets, with no change in efficiency (very good).
